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Shepreth to Corkerhill start from as little as £40.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Shepreth to Corkerhill start from £93.10 one way, or £208.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Shepreth to Corkerhill are available for £196.40 one way, or £443.20 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Services

Though Shepreth station lacks a formal ticket office, ticket machines are conveniently available for all your ticketing needs, including online ticket collection. These machines are also equipped to provide disc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ders, ensuring accessibility for all travelers. Departure screens and announcement systems keep passengers informed, while help points are strategically placed on platforms for additional assistance when needed.

Accessibility is a key focus at Shepreth, with step-free access provided to both platforms through separate entrances. However, note that further assistance might be required for access between trains and platforms. If needed, staff-operated ramps are available, and a mobile assistance team is on hand to ensure seamless boarding. For those planning a trip, it's wise to arrive about 20 minutes before the train's departure.

Travel Connections

Shepreth station offers direct train connections to a variety of popular destinations. Frequent services run to bustling city centers such as Cambridge and London Kings Cross, making it an ideal boarding point for both local and long-distance travelers. Other popular routes include journeys to Royston, Letchworth Garden City, and Stevenage.

Onward travel from Shepreth station is well-supported with local bus services and taxis, ensuring an easy transition from train to other modes of transport. For updated bus schedules and rail replacement service details, travelers can consult the station's Onward Travel Information Map. Corkerhill Station Facilities

At Corkerhill, simplicity is the key. Though the station lacks a ticket office or machines, buying tickets is a breeze online and smartcard users can validate their cards here. The station ensures accessibility with step-free access throughout, classified as a Category A station. For safety and security, there's a customer help point and CCTV coverage ensuring that all passengers can travel with confidence.

While amenities such as restrooms, refreshment facilities, and shops are not available at the station, Corkerhill does offer a seating area for those waiting for their train. Despite the lack of some services, the station maintains a tidy and efficient environment perfect for transit.

Onward Travel Options from Corkerhill

Getting around from Corkerhill is straightforward due to its well-connected transport links. The station serves as a pick-up and drop-off point for rail replacement services on Corkerhill Road, just before the bridge. Taxis can be conveniently booked through the Train Taxi service. For bus services, you can visit Travel Line Scotland or give them a call for any queries about routes and timings. Bus stops are easily accessible, ensuring a smooth transition between rail and road travel.
